The Indian small and medium enterprise (SME) sector's participation and role in the field of aviation and aerospace component manufacturing is far behind its global counterparts, according to industry players.
There are about 25 to 30 SMEs who have taken the business for manufacturing aviation and aerospace component seriously. "It is a long term investment for them. It is highly capital intensive industry. I definitely believe there can be many more of them," said Country Head of UTC Aerospace Systems, Chris Rao.
"This is a reason why Indian aviation and aerospace component industry is far behind in terms of growth in comparison with the global growth rate. It is a USD 930 billion industry globally and India’s share is not even half the percentage. We want India to at least catch up to 10 percent of the global growth in the near future," he added.
When asked what kind of challenges these SMEs are facing in manufacturing aerospace and aviation components, he said that SME sector's participation in the component level manufacturing is poor.
